AG Garland: ‘Democracy Is Not a State, It Is an Act’

‘And each generation must do its part’

TRANSCRIPT:

GARLAND: "Democracy is not a state, it is an act, and each generation must do its part. Thanks to all of your work, the Department of Justice will always stand up to ensure the survival of the central pillar of our democracy."
